A historic church, built in 1752 has been put on the market for £150,000 , complete with planning permission to transform it into a family residence.
This nearly 300-year-old property not only comes with a host of modern additions but also retains its original stunning stained glass. The heritage character of the building is preserved with the original pulpit remaining intact.
Moreover, there are plans to repurpose the existing pews and timber panelling into new furniture. With high ceilings and a charming rural backdrop, Roxburgh Church could become a truly unique home.
